Suspended Ceiling Materials: A Look at Safety and Sustainability

When it comes to selecting stretch ceiling materials, homeowners and contractors alike must consider several factors that ensure best possible performance and safety while minimizing greenhouse gas emissions. Modern ceiling systems are regularly crafted from a wide selection of materials, each with its own unique set of benefits.

Some popular options include PVC (polyvinyl chloride), known for its robustness, and polyester fabric, possesses excellent flame retardancy. Moreover, newer materials like polyurethane (PU) and eco-friendly fabrics are gaining traction due to their low carbon footprint.

It's essential to carefully here assess the purpose of the ceiling, along with any local regulations, when making a decision. Clearness regarding materials and their production methods is important to ensuring both safety and sustainability.

Can Stretch Ceilings Affect Air Quality? Exploring the Impact of Stretch Ceiling Materials

Stretch ceilings have become a popular choice for modern homes and commercial spaces, delivering a seamless and stylish look. However, questions about their impact on air quality and the environment continue to arise. Some materials used in stretch ceilings, such as PVC, could release volatile organic compounds (VOCs) into the air, which can contribute to indoor air pollution and trigger respiratory problems. Furthermore, the manufacturing and disposal of stretch ceiling materials frequently include resources and energy, raising concerns about their environmental footprint.

Choosing a breathable, low-VOC ceiling option can help mitigate the potential risks. Consumers should pay attention to the materials used in stretch ceilings and investigate the manufacturer's environmental practices.

Beyond Aesthetics: Ensuring the Safety and Longevity of Stretch Ceilings

While stretch ceilings offer undeniable visual appeal, prioritizing their safety and longevity is paramount. These suspended systems require careful installation by qualified professionals to ensure secure attachment and proper weight distribution. Selecting durable materials that resist moisture damage and fading from UV exposure is crucial for long-term performance. Regular inspections and prompt maintenance, including cleaning and addressing any signs of wear or damage, can significantly extend the lifespan of your stretch ceiling investment.
